  • The city of 16,000 inhabitants on the upper Tiber is located in the far east of Tuscany. Sansepolcro was probably founded at the beginning of the 11th century. According to legend, two holy pilgrims, Arcanus and Aegidius, stopped in this valley on their return from the Holy Land and, by a divine sign, they decided to stay and build a small chapel to house the holy relics they had brought with them from Jerusalem , to keep.
    Sansepolcro Cathedral, officially a co-cathedral, has ancient origins, having been founded more than 1,000 years ago as a Benedictine abbey on the pilgrimage routes to preserve the aforementioned relic of the Holy Sepulchre.

  • Tradition has it that the city was founded around the 10th century by two pilgrims returning from the Holy Land. To preserve the relics from the Holy Sepulchre, they built an oratory with an adjoining hospital for pilgrims. The town of Borgo San Sepolcro was born around these buildings, later transformed into Sansepolcro. The current appearance of the center is from the Renaissance period, parts of the city walls built by the Medici family are still present.
